MediaStreamSourceStartingRequest 类

定义

表示来自 MediaStreamSource.Starting 事件的请求,以便应用程序从媒体中的特定位置开始累积 MediaStreamSample 对象。

public ref class MediaStreamSourceStartingRequest s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class MediaStreamSourceStartingRequest final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class MediaStreamSourceStartingRequest
Public NotInheritable Class MediaStreamSourceStartingRequest
继承
Object Platform::Object IInspectable MediaStreamSourceStartingRequest
属性

Windows 要求

设备系列
Windows 10 (在 10.0.10240.0 中引入)
API contract
Windows.Foundation.UniversalApiContract (在 v1.0 中引入)

注解

有关在 UWP 应用中使用媒体流源的示例,请参阅 MediaStreamSource 示例

属性

StartPosition

指定对 TimeSpan 对象的引用,该对象表示应用程序应从中返回 MediaStreamSample 对象的媒体时间行中的时间位置。

方法

GetDeferral()

延迟完成 MediaStreamSource.Starting 事件。

SetActualStartPosition(TimeSpan)

指定将传递到 MediaStreamSource 的后续 MediaStreamSamples媒体时间行中的起始位置。

适用于

另请参阅